Man shot in front of his home while preparing to go to work

By Khalida Sarwari

A 43-year-old man was shot in front of his home in Salinas as he was preparing to go to work Thursday morning, according to police.

The shooting, which appears to have been gang-related, occurred at about 7:10 a.m. at a home in the 500 block of Sunrise Street.

Police said a small, gray sedan with dark-tinted windows drove up to the house, and one of two occupants shot the victim several times as he was standing by the trunk of his car.

The car then fled toward Del Monte Avenue, police said.

The victim suffered gunshot wounds to his chest, lower back, buttocks and thigh, but his injuries were not considered life threatening.

He was transported to a Bay Area hospital for treatment.
